Structural Grade Breakdown
Lean Mix & Blinding (C10 / GEN 1)
Low-cement ratio for unreinforced fill. Forms a clean, level sub-base over raw clay to protect steel reinforcement during foundation construction.
Domestic Structural (C20 / GEN 3)
Standard residential formulation for single-storey building extensions, garden wall footings, greenhouse slabs, and post securing.
Engineered Footings (C25 / FND 2)
High-strength foundation blend formulated to resist sulphate ground attacks. Standard choice for building control approval in trench digs.
Reinforced Pavement (C30 / PAV 1)
Frost-resistant external concrete engineered for commercial vehicle crossovers, double garage floors, and heavy-duty reinforced raft slabs.
Water-Resistant Structural (C35 & C40)
Hydrophobic crystalline admixtures reduce permeability, safeguarding subterranean basement walls against Thames groundwater pressure.
Polymer Floor Screeds
Fine aggregate sand-and-cement screed designed to encapsulate underfloor heating pipes and deliver a dead-flat substrate for tiling or timber.
Performance Admixtures & Quality Control
Polypropylene Micro-Fibres
Distributed throughout the batch to dramatically reduce plastic shrinkage cracking and improve impact resistance on surface slabs.
Set Retarders & Accelerators
Adjust hydration timing to grant finishing crews extended working windows in summer heat or accelerate strength gain in colder weather.
Water-Reducing Plasticisers
Increase flowability to encapsulate congested rebar cages without compromising final 28-day compressive strength.
